Description
The Tube MP Project Series takes ART’s long-running Tube MP design and reworks it top to bottom, pairing a hand-selected 12AX7A tube with a discrete, low-noise front end. The result is a compact preamp that can drive up to 70dB of clean, musical gain into a mixer, audio interface, or recording console — useful for anything from vocals and acoustic instruments to line-level sources that need a bit more character.
Beyond gain, this update brings a genuinely useful feature set: a fast FET limiter to catch unexpected peaks before they clip, switchable input impedance to better match different mics and instruments, and precision LED metering so you can actually see what’s happening to your signal. The all-aluminum, stackable chassis is built for multi-unit setups, and built-in phantom power means you’re ready for condenser mics right out of the box.

Core specs:
- Dynamic range: >100dB (20Hz–20kHz)
- Frequency response: 10Hz–40kHz, ±1dB (typical)
- Input impedance: switchable 4.7k / 600 Ohms (XLR)
- Maximum gain: 70dB (XLR–XLR), +50dB (1/4″–XLR)
- Tube type: 12AX7A, hand selected
- Dimensions: 6.5″D x 5.9″W x 1.75″H; weight 2.5 lbs
